The VACUUBRAND MZ 2C NT is one of the most versatile chemistry diaphragm pumps in the VACUUBRAND lineup. Its two-stage design provides significantly deeper vacuum than basic filtration pumps while maintaining the oil-free, chemically resistant advantages that make diaphragm technology attractive for solvent and reagent applications.
All components exposed to pumped media are manufactured from chemically resistant fluoroplastics. VACUUBRAND also uses PTFE sandwich diaphragms designed to increase reliability and service life under demanding laboratory conditions. This construction makes the MZ 2C NT particularly well suited for continuous pumping of chemical vapors that would contaminate the oil in a conventional rotary vane pump.
The integrated gas ballast valve improves condensable-vapor handling by allowing continuous condensate purge. This helps maintain useful pumping performance when water vapor or other condensable substances are present during evaporation, concentration, or drying workflows.

| Specification | Details |
|---|---|
| Manufacturer | VACUUBRAND |
| Model | MZ 2C NT |
| Equipment Type | Chemistry Diaphragm Vacuum Pump |
| U.S. Article Number | 20732303 |
| Pump Design | Oil-Free Chemistry Diaphragm |
| Number of Heads | 2 |
| Number of Stages | 2 |
| Maximum Pumping Speed at 60 Hz | 1.4 cfm |
| Maximum Pumping Speed at 50 Hz | 2.0 m³/h |
| Ultimate Vacuum | 7 mbar / 5 Torr |
| Ultimate Vacuum with Gas Ballast | 12 mbar / 9 Torr |
| Maximum Back Pressure | 1.1 bar absolute |
| Inlet Connection | Hose Nozzle DN 8–10 mm |
| Outlet Connection | Hose Nozzle DN 8–10 mm |
| Rated Motor Power | 0.18 kW / 180 W |
| Rated Motor Speed | 1500 rpm at 50 Hz / 1800 rpm at 60 Hz |
| Operating Ambient Temperature | 10°C to 40°C |
| Storage Temperature | -10°C to 60°C |
| Dimensions (L × W × H) | 243 × 243 × 198 mm (9.6 × 9.6 × 7.8 in.) |
| Weight | 11.1 kg (24.5 lb) |
| Sound Pressure Level | Approximately 45 dBA |
| Protection Class | IP40 |
| ATEX Conformity | II 3/- G Ex h IIC T3 Gc X, Internal Atmosphere Only |
| Electrical Requirements | 100–115 VAC, 50/60 Hz; 120 VAC, 60 Hz U.S. configuration |
| Certification | NRTL Certified |

Energy Efficiency & Operating Costs
The MZ 2C NT uses a 180-watt motor and operates without vacuum pump oil. This eliminates oil purchases, oil changes, contaminated-oil disposal, oil mist, and oil backstreaming into laboratory processes.
For laboratories working with solvents or corrosive vapors, oil-free operation can also reduce maintenance because there is no oil reservoir available for solvent contamination. The maintenance-free drive system and long-life PTFE sandwich diaphragms are designed to further reduce routine service requirements.
The compact pump body also allows laboratories to dedicate the MZ 2C NT to a particular evaporator, concentrator, or vacuum workstation without requiring a large centralized vacuum installation.

Chemical resistance is one of the defining strengths of the MZ 2C NT.
VACUUBRAND manufactures the wetted components from chemically resistant fluoroplastics, while PTFE sandwich diaphragms provide a robust barrier between the process gases and the mechanical drive system.
This makes the pump particularly useful for continuous handling of aggressive or solvent-rich vapors that can quickly degrade general-purpose vacuum pumps.
Chemical compatibility should still be verified for the specific substances, concentrations, temperatures, and operating conditions involved.
The MZ 2C NT uses a two-stage diaphragm arrangement to achieve an ultimate vacuum of approximately 7 mbar / 5 Torr.
Two-stage construction allows substantially lower ultimate pressure than a single-stage diaphragm pump while maintaining useful pumping speed.
This pressure range supports many common laboratory evaporation and concentration workflows, especially when reduced boiling temperature is desirable for heat-sensitive samples.
The integrated gas ballast valve helps improve performance when condensable vapors are present.
Without gas ballast, the MZ 2C NT reaches approximately 7 mbar. With gas ballast in use, ultimate vacuum is approximately 12 mbar / 9 Torr.
Gas ballast allows condensate to be purged more effectively during pumping, which can be useful for water vapor and suitable solvent vapors generated during evaporation or drying processes.
The MZ 2C NT is a strong vacuum source for many laboratory rotary evaporators.
Its 7 mbar ultimate vacuum supports evaporation of numerous common solvents at reduced temperatures, while the chemistry-resistant diaphragm design avoids the oil contamination issues associated with rotary vane pumps.
Because the standard MZ 2C NT is a fixed-speed pump without automatic electronic vacuum control, vacuum regulation may be handled with a manual valve, external vacuum controller, or compatible accessory depending on the process.

Both pumps are chemically resistant diaphragm pumps, but the MZ 2C NT provides substantially deeper vacuum.
The ME 1C reaches approximately 100 mbar and is particularly well suited for vacuum filtration, aspiration, and moderate-vacuum laboratory work.
The MZ 2C NT reaches 7 mbar, making it much better suited for rotary evaporation, vacuum concentration, solvent evaporation, and other applications requiring deeper vacuum.
For straightforward filtration, the ME 1C may be sufficient. For broader chemical vacuum duties, the MZ 2C NT offers significantly greater process capability.
Both pumps use two-stage chemistry diaphragm technology and reach approximately 7 mbar ultimate vacuum, but their control systems differ significantly.
The MZ 2C NT is a fixed-speed pump. It provides a dependable vacuum source that can be paired with manual controls, separators, condensers, or external controllers as required.
The MZ 2C VARIO Select incorporates variable-speed motor control and the VACUU·SELECT electronic controller for automatic pressure regulation and solvent boiling-point detection.
For laboratories that want a simple, durable chemistry vacuum pump, the MZ 2C NT is an excellent choice. For automated rotary evaporation and process control, the VARIO Select version provides additional capability.

The VACUUBRAND MZ 2C NT is supplied completely assembled and ready for use.
The U.S. configuration supports 100–115 VAC at 50/60 Hz and 120 VAC at 60 Hz. Buyers should verify the exact electrical configuration on the pump nameplate before installation. (shop.vacuubrand.com)
Both inlet and outlet use DN 8–10 mm hose nozzles. Vacuum tubing should be sufficiently rigid for vacuum service and chemically compatible with the vapors being processed.
For applications involving substantial liquid carryover, high condensate loads, hazardous vapors, or solvent recovery requirements, laboratories should evaluate appropriate separators, cold traps, exhaust condensers, ventilation, and other engineering controls.
